Comets' Celestial Dance
The year 2026 is set to be a spectacular time for comet enthusiasts, with several celestial visitors offering unique viewing opportunities. Comet MAPS
is poised for a critical moment as it approaches the sun around April 4th, raising hopes it might become visible even in daylight. Similarly, Comet Wierzchos is expected to grace our skies as it makes a close pass by the sun. Early spring might also bring the 'great comet' of 2026 with Comet C/2025 R3 (PanSTARRS) potentially putting on a significant show. Beyond these, Comet 24P/Schaumasse is also scheduled for its closest solar approach, though its visibility remains a question. The mysterious interstellar comet 3I/ATLAS, potentially billions of years old and originating from a long-gone star system, has been observed by NASA's space telescope flaring up while it departs our solar system. Astronomers are also still actively searching for the remnants of a 'dead' comet years after its initial discovery, pondering if any material still lingers. The Hubble Space Telescope has even captured the dramatic event of comet C/2025 K1 (ATLAS) fragmenting, and has also observed a doomed comet unexpectedly reversing its spin, adding to the dynamic nature of these icy wanderers.
Asteroids and Planetary Defense
Our solar system's rocky inhabitants are also taking center stage in 2026. A bus-sized asteroid, discovered only days prior to its flyby, is set to pass Earth at a safe distance, offering a reminder of the constant cosmic traffic around us. Looking further afield, Europe has ambitious plans to land a small spacecraft on the notorious asteroid Apophis in 2029, a mission that will provide invaluable data on these celestial bodies. NASA's groundbreaking DART planetary defense mission has already yielded fascinating insights, revealing that its impact on an asteroid caused the celestial bodies to hurl 'cosmic snowballs' at each other, significantly altering their orbits. The technology behind tracking these objects is also advancing, with advancements in Lithuanian technology solutions aiming to address future challenges in space exploration and asteroid tracking. Furthermore, scientists are now able to trace meteorites and asteroids back to their specific origins within the solar system, deepening our understanding of their formation and history. The Psyche spacecraft, en route to a metal-rich asteroid, has even beamed back a haunting view of distant Earth, showcasing the profound perspective gained from deep space missions.
Artemis 2: Lunar Ambitions
The Artemis 2 mission to the moon is a cornerstone of NASA's renewed lunar ambitions in 2026. Astronauts will embark on a historic journey, with detailed plans outlining their activities for each day of the mission. However, the mission's launch timeline has been subject to scrutiny, with new analyses suggesting a delay until late 2026 due to concerns about potential solar superflares. NASA has affirmed that a large solar flare observed posed no threat to the planned astronaut launch. Nevertheless, contingency planning is in place, addressing what might happen if the Artemis 2 astronauts encounter a solar storm during their mission. To support scientific endeavors, stargazers with Unistellar smart telescopes will have the opportunity to track the Artemis 2 rocket's light curve as part of a citizen science initiative. Amidst the preparations and discussions, the Artemis 2 astronauts have also shared a charming detail: their zero-g indicator, named 'Rise', has been revealed, adding a personal touch to the monumental mission.
